Persona Q/Q2 (US) Patches

A set of assembly patches for Persona Q (USA) and Persona Q2 (USA).

Included patches:

  • MC Canon Names (Names[.s|.hks]) - For PQ/PQ2

    Patches the MC name functions to display the "canon" names. Normally the player can't fit some of these names in the name input boxes due to their length.

    The set names are:

    • P3MC - Makoto Yuki (PQ/PQ2)
    • P4MC - Yu Narukami (PQ/PQ2)
    • P3PMC - Kotone Shiomi (PQ2)
    • P5MC - Ren Amamiya (PQ2)
  • Mod Support (ModCpk[.s|.hks]) - For PQ/PQ2

    Enables file replacement via a mod.cpk file.

    A mod.cpk file has to be present in romfs when using the mod.cpk patch, otherwise the game will crash.

    An empty mod.cpk file (containing only an empty dummy.txt file) is provided with each mod.cpk patch - replace it with your own if you want to replace game files.

Usage

Relevant Title IDs for this section:

  • PQ (USA) - 0004000000123400
  • PQ2 (USA) - 00040000001D7100

3DS (Luma3DS)

  1. Download the latest release.

  2. Create a mod directory for the game you are trying to patch (sd:/luma/titles/<title_id>).

  3. Place the files for the game you are trying to patch in the following paths:

    sd:/luma/titles/<title_id>/exheader.bin
    sd:/luma/titles/<title_id>/code.bin
    sd:/luma/titles/<title_id>/romfs/mod.cpk
  4. Launch the game.

Citra

  1. Download the latest release.

  2. Right click on the relevant game entry and select "Open Mods Location".

  3. Place the files for the game you are trying to patch in the following paths:

    <citra_vfs>/load/mods/<title_id>/exefs/code.bin
    <citra_vfs>/load/mods/<title_id>/exheader.bin
    <citra_vfs>/load/mods/<title_id>/romfs/mod.cpk
  4. Launch the game.

Building

  1. Setup Magikoopa.
  2. Dump code.bin and exheader.bin from the game you are trying to patch.
  3. Launch Magikoopa and set the working directory to the pq or pq2 patch folders, depending on the game you are trying to patch. Put the aforementioned code.bin and exheader.bin files in the patch folder.
  4. If you don't want to include some of the patches, move the relevant patch files out of the source folder in the working directory.
  5. Click "Make and Insert". This should generate a patched code.bin and exheader.bin in the patch folder.
  6. See Usage for further instructions.
